@charset "gb2312";
*{ padding:0px; margin:0px;}
body{margin:0px auto; font-family:"宋体";font-size:12px;color:#333; width:100%; background:#ffffff}
ul,li,b,h1,h2,b,u,img,form{border:0px;margin:0px;padding:0px;font-size:12px;font-weight:normal;list-style-type: none;text-decoration: none;} 
a{text-decoration:none; color:#333333;}
a:hover{color:#2d65ba;}
/*-----------------------------------公共----------------------------*/
#wrap{ width: auto; height:auto; margin:0 auto;}
/*-----------------------------------时间----------------------------*/
.time{ width:1003px; height:37px; margin:0 auto; overflow:hidden;}
.time_right{ width:650px; float:left; line-height:37px; height:37px;padding-left:25px; background: url(imagesgb2011t02_03.jpg) no-repeat left center;}
.time_left{ width:280px; float:left; line-height:22px; height:22px; margin:10px 10px 0 20px;}
.time_left ul{ width:171px; height:22px;background: url(imagesgb2011i01.jpg) no-repeat; padding-left:10px; float:left;}
.time_left ul li{ margin:0px 0px 0px 0px; float:left; font-size:10px; padding:0 2px 0 2px;font-family:Arial, Helvetica, sans-serif; letter-spacing:-1px;color:#FFF;}
.time_left ul li a{ color:#ffffff;}
.time_left ul li a:hover{ color:#004890;}
.eng{ float:right; margin:5px 10px 0 0;}

/*-----------------------------------导航----------------------------*/
.nav{ width:1003px; height:39px; margin:0 auto; background:url(imagesgb2011nav.jpg) no-repeat;}
.nav ul{ padding-left:45px;}
.nav ul li{ width:88px;float:left; font-size:14px; line-height:39px; padding-left:3px;}
.nav ul li a{ color:#ffffff;}
.nav ul li a:hover{ color:#ff9c00;}

/*-----------------------------------头部----------------------------*/
.header{ width:1003px; height:199px; margin:0 auto; overflow:hidden; }

/*-----------------------------------广告----------------------------*/
.banner{ width:1003px; height:78px; margin:0 auto; overflow:hidden; background:#ef402c;}
/*-----------------------------------主体内容----------------------------*/

.content01,.content02,.content03,.content04,.content06{ width:1003px; height:auto; margin:10px auto 0px; overflow:hidden;}
/*-----------------------------------flash图片----------------------------*/
.flash{ width:224px; height:224px; float:left; overflow:hidden;}
.flash_title{ width:224px; height:24px; float:left; background:url(imagesgb2011index05_08.jpg) no-repeat;}
.flash_list{ width:214px; height:190px; background:#1f68b6; float:left; padding:10px 0 0 10px;}

/*-----------------------------------行业动态----------------------------*/
.trade{ width:466px; height:224px; float:left; margin-left:9px; overflow:hidden;}
.trade_title{ width:466px; height:24px; float:left; background:url(imagesgb2011index05_10.jpg) no-repeat;}
.trade_title a{ float:right;}
.trade_list{ width:466px; height:200px; float:left; overflow:hidden;}
.list01{ width:88px; height:190px; float:left; background:#dadada; margin-top:10px;}
.list01 ul{ padding:0; margin:12px 0 0 11px;}
.list01 ul li{ padding-bottom:10px;}
.list02{width:378px; height:190px; float:left;margin-top:10px;}
.list02 ul{ padding:0px 0px 0px 10px;  overflow:hidden;}
.list02 ul li{ line-height:28px; }
.list02 ul li a{ color:#1e1e1e; }
.list02 ul li a:hover{ color:#c70000;}
.list02 ul li span{ float:right; margin-right:10px; color:#8a8585;}


/*-----------------------------------通知公告----------------------------*/
.notice{ width:294px; height:224px; float:right; overflow:hidden;}
.notice_title{ width:294px; height:24px; float:left; background:url(imagesgb2011index05_12.jpg) no-repeat;}
.notice_title a{ float:right;}
.notice_list{ width:294px; height:190px; float:left; background:#efefef; margin-top:10px;}
.notice_list ul{ padding:0px 0px 0px 3px;  overflow:hidden;}
.notice_list ul li{ line-height:28px; background:url(imagesgb2011tt.gif) 5px 8px no-repeat; padding-left:20px;}
.notice_list ul li a{ color:#1e1e1e; }
.notice_list ul li a:hover{ color:#c70000;}
.notice_list ul li span{ float:right; margin-right:10px; color:#8a8585;}

/*-----------------------------------广告----------------------------*/

.con03_left{ width:702px; height:672px; float:left; overflow:hidden;}
.con03_left ul{ margin:0; padding:0;}
.con03_left ul li{ padding-bottom:2px;}
.con03_right{ width:294px; height:672px; float:right; overflow:hidden;}

/*----------------------------------人才需求----------------------------*/
.talents{ width:294px; height:168px; float:left; overflow:hidden;}
.talents_title{ width:294px; height:31px; float:left; overflow:hidden; background:url(imagesgb2011index05_34.jpg) no-repeat;}
.talents_list{ width:294px; height:135px; float:left; overflow:hidden;}
.talents_list ul{ margin:10px 0 0 8px;}
.talents_list ul li{ padding-bottom:8px;}
/*----------------------------------下载专栏----------------------------*/

.download{ width:294px; height:204px; float:left; overflow:hidden;}
.download_title{ width:294px; height:31px; float:left; overflow:hidden; background:url(imagesgb2011index05_44.jpg) no-repeat;}
.download_title a{ float:right; margin-top:3px;}
.download_list{ width:292px; height:161px; float:left; margin-top:10px; border:#c6d4de solid 1px;}
.download_list ul{ margin:5px 0 0 3px;}
.download_list ul li{ text-align:center; float:left; display:block;width:286px; height:30px; line-height:30px; color:#28528b;background:url(imagesgb2011index05_45.jpg) no-repeat; font-size:14px; font-weight:800;}
.download_list ul li a{color:#28528b; display:block;}
.download_list ul li.zc{ background:url(imagesgb2011zc.jpg) no-repeat;}
.download_list ul li.px{ background:url(imagesgb2011px.jpg) no-repeat;}
.download_list ul li.jg{ background:url(imagesgb2011jg.jpg) no-repeat;}
.download_list ul li.hy{ background:url(imagesgb2011hy.jpg) no-repeat;}
.download_list ul li.qt{ background:url(imagesgb2011qt.jpg) no-repeat;}


/*----------------------------------邮箱登陆----------------------------*/
.login{ width:294px; height:124px; float:left; overflow:hidden;}
.login_title{ width:294px; height:31px; float:left; background:url(imagesgb2011index05_55.jpg) no-repeat;}
.login_list{ width:294px; height:93px; float:left;background:url(imagesgb2011index05_52.jpg) repeat-x bottom;}
.login_list ul{ margin-left:35px;}
.login_list ul li{ line-height:20px;margin-top:5px; height:20px; padding-bottom:3px;}
.login_list ul li img{ padding-left:15px;}
.login_list ul li span{ float:left; color:#3d3d3d;}
.login_list ul li input{ width:113px; height:18px; border:1px solid #6d869b;margin-left:8px; vertical-align:middle; float:left; }


/*----------------------------------友情链接----------------------------*/
.links{ width:294px; height:167px; float:left; overflow:hidden; margin-top:5px;}
.links_title{ width:294px; height:31px; float:left; background:url(imagesgb2011index05_58.jpg) no-repeat;}
.links_list{ width:294px; height:136px; float:left; background:url(imagesgb2011index05_52.jpg) repeat-x bottom;}
.links_list ul{ margin:5px 0 0 3px;}
.links_list ul li{ text-align:center; float:left; display:block;width:286px; line-height:26px; color:#28528b; font-size:14px; font-weight:800;}
.links_list ul li a{color:#28528b; display:block;}
.links_list ul li a:hover{color:#28528b; font-weight:lighter;}


/*----------------------------------页脚----------------------------*/
.footer{ width:1003px; height:110px; margin:0px auto 0px; overflow:hidden; background:#6d96c2; text-align:center; color:#FFF; padding-top:0px;}

/*----------------------------------列表页----------------------------*/
.con05{ width:1003px;  margin:0 auto; overflow:hidden;height:auto; background:url(imagesgb2011list_bj01.jpg) no-repeat left bottom;}
.con05_all{ width:1003px; height:auto; margin:10px 0 10px 10px; overflow:hidden; background:url(imagesgb2011bj011.jpg) repeat-y bottom left;}
.con05_left{ width:203px; height:auto; float:left; overflow:hidden;}
#program{width:201px; height:auto;border:#c0c0c0 solid 1px; border-bottom:none;}
#program h3{ margin-top:10px;line-height:25px; color:#FFFFFF; font-size:14px;background:url(imagesgb2011red_bg.jpg) center center no-repeat; text-align:center;}
#sub_nav{width:157px;margin:10px 0px 0px 26px; min-height:350px; height:350px;}
div[id]#sub_nav{ height:auto;}
#sub_nav ul li{font-weight:bold; color:#000; background:url(imagesgb2011opactity.gif) 0px 11px no-repeat; padding-left:20px;height:34px; line-height:34px; text-align:left; border-bottom:#CCC dotted 1px;}
#sub_nav ul li a{color:#002a5f; }
#sub_nav ul li a:hover{color:#b1161d; }
.con05_right{ width:780px; height:auto; float:left; margin-left:10px;overflow:hidden;}
.list05_title{ width:780px; height:29px; background:url(imagesgb2011link_bj.jpg) no-repeat #FFF left;line-height:29px;}
.list05_title h1{ color:#0a397a;background:url(imagesgb2011guide_ico.gif) 8px 8px no-repeat;}
.list05_title h1 span{ color:#ffffff; font-size:14px; font-weight:700; padding-left:35px; }
.list05_title h1 a{ color:#0a397a;}
.list05_title h1 a:hover{ color:#FFF;}
.list05_list{ width:780px; height:auto; float:left; overflow:hidden;}
.list05_list ul{ padding:0px 0px 0px 10px;  overflow:hidden; min-height:400px; height:400px;}
div[class].list05_list ul{ height:auto;}
.list05_list ul li{ line-height:28px; background:url(imagesgb2011tt01.gif) 0px 8px no-repeat; padding-left:15px;}
.list05_list ul li a{ color:#1e1e1e; }
.list05_list ul li a:hover{ color:#c70000;}
.list05_list ul li span{ float:right; margin-right:10px; color:#8a8585;}

/*-----------------------------------分页----------------------------*/
.list_sort{ width:96%; background:#f1f1f1; height:30px; line-height:30px;
            margin:15px 0 10px 15px; _margin:15px 0 10px 8px;text-align:center; float:left; *float:none; color:#333;} 
.list_sort a{ color:#333;}
.list_sort a:hover{ color:#D12F21;}

/*-----------------------------------文章页----------------------------*/
.con06_title{ width:1003px; height:29px; background:url(imagesgb2011link_bj.jpg) no-repeat #FFF left;line-height:29px;}
.con06_title h1{ color:#0a397a;background:url(imagesgb2011guide_ico.gif) 8px 8px no-repeat;}
.con06_title h1 span{ color:#ffffff; font-size:14px; font-weight:700; padding-left:35px; }
.con06_title h1 a{ color:#0a397a;}
.con06_title h1 a:hover{ color:#FFF;}

#main_b1{width:100%;height:auto;  margin:10px 0px 0px 0px; float:left; display:inline; background:url(imagesgb2011index05_52.jpg) repeat-x bottom;}
#main_b1 h3{float:none; width:auto;height:38px; text-align:center; line-height:40px; color:#c90000; font-size:16px; height:50px; padding:15px 0px 0px 0px; }
#main_b1 #author{width:95%;font-size:24px; font-weight:bold;text-align:center; margin:10px auto ; clear:both; }
#main_b1 #author a{color:#000000;}
#main_b1 #work{width:90%; height:auto;  margin:20px auto 30px; text-align:left; line-height:26px; color:#1d1d1d; font-size:14px;}
#author02{width:95%; line-height:22px; text-align:center; margin:10px auto; clear:both; background:#d4efff;}
#author02 a{color:#000000;}

#beside{width:95%; height:auto; margin:10px auto 0px; }
#beside h3{width:95%; height:30px; line-height:30px; color:#1c4e8c; text-align:left; font-size:12px; }
#beside ul{ width:95%;overflow:hidden; padding-bottom:10px;}
#beside ul li{border-bottom:#ccc dotted 1px;height:22px; line-height:22px;width:100%; overflow:hidden; padding:0px 0px 0px 20px; }
#beside ul li a{color:#333;}
#beside ul li a:hover{color:#044DB3;}
#beside ul li span{float:right; color:#333; margin:0px 30px 0px 0px;}


/*-----------------------------------列表页2----------------------------*/
.list06{ width:1003px; height:auto; float:left;overflow:hidden; background:url(imagesgb2011index05_52.jpg) bottom repeat-x;}
.list06 ul{ padding:10px 0px 0px 10px;  overflow:hidden; min-height:400px; height:400px;}
div[class].list06 ul{ height:auto;}
.list06 ul li{ line-height:28px; background:url(imagesgb2011tt01.gif) 0px 10px no-repeat; padding-left:15px; border-bottom:#CCC dotted 1px;}
.list06 ul li a{ color:#1e1e1e; }
.list06 ul li a:hover{ color:#c70000;}
.list06 ul li span{ float:right; margin-right:10px; color:#8a8585;}


/*-----------------------------------图片列表----------------------------*/
.con07_title{ width:1003px; height:24px; float:left;background:#628fbc; overflow:hidden;}
.con07_title h1{ float:left; line-height:24px; font-size:14px; font-weight:700; padding-left:10px; color:#FFF;}
.con07_title a{ float:right; margin:0px 10px 0 0;}
.con07_list{ width:1003px; height:auto; float:left;overflow:hidden; background:url(imagesgb2011index05_52.jpg) bottom repeat-x; padding-bottom:10px;}
.con07_list ul{ padding:10px 0px 0px 10px;  overflow:hidden; }
.con07_list ul li{ line-height:28px; background:url(imagesgb2011tt01.gif) 0px 10px no-repeat; padding-left:15px; border-bottom:#CCC dotted 1px;}
.con07_list ul li a{ color:#1e1e1e; }
.con07_list ul li a:hover{ color:#c70000;}
.con07_list ul li span{ float:right; margin-right:10px; color:#8a8585;}
